We are peaking, we feel strong and fast, the weather eases up so we feel even better; we feel GREAT and the taper is approaching... this is when most of us mess up.I like to repeat LESS IS MOREBut what is less and what is more? I tell myself THIS IS THE TIME TO BE CONSERVATIVEBut how do I know I am being conservative enough?

Well... enter the new and reformed:

JUST ONE HANDICAP AT A TIME

If it's hot, back off on the pace.
If you're going long, back off on the pace.
If you're doing hills, back off on everything else.
If you're doing speedwork, don't wear the wrong gear.
and so on...
